1. California Institute of the Arts (CalArts)
Located in Valencia, California, CalArts is renowned for its top-tier animation program. The program offers a Bachelor of Fine Arts (BFA) in Character Animation that provides students with comprehensive training in traditional and digital animation techniques. CalArts boasts a distinguished faculty of industry professionals and a strong emphasis on storytelling and character development.

2. Sheridan College
Based in Oakville, Ontario, Canada, Sheridan College is home to an esteemed Bachelor of Animation program. Known for its hands-on approach to animation education, Sheridan College equips students with the technical skills and creative vision needed to succeed in the animation industry. Graduates of the program have gone on to work at top animation studios such as Pixar, Disney, and DreamWorks.

3. Ringling College of Art and Design
Located in Sarasota, Florida, Ringling College of Art and Design offers a Bachelor of Fine Arts (BFA) in Computer Animation. The program combines artistic expression with technical expertise, preparing students for careers in 3D animation, visual effects, and interactive media. Ringling College is known for its state-of-the-art facilities and strong industry connections, providing students with valuable networking opportunities.

4. Savannah College of Art and Design (SCAD)
With campuses in Savannah, Georgia, and Atlanta, Georgia, SCAD offers a range of animation programs at the undergraduate and graduate levels. SCAD’s Bachelor of Fine Arts (BFA) in Animation program covers a wide variety of animation techniques, from traditional hand-drawn animation to 3D modeling and rigging. SCAD’s faculty includes award-winning animators and industry professionals who mentor students to help them reach their full potential.

5. Gobelins School of Visual Arts
Located in Paris, France, Gobelins School of Visual Arts is recognized as one of the premier animation schools in the world. The school offers a Bachelor of Fine Arts (BFA) in Character Animation and a range of specialized animation programs at the graduate level. Gobelins is known for its rigorous curriculum, emphasis on collaboration, and strong connections to the animation industry in Europe and beyond.

6. Vancouver Film School (VFS)
Based in Vancouver, British Columbia, Canada, VFS offers a one-year Diploma in Animation that provides intensive training in 2D and 3D animation techniques. The program is designed to quickly develop students’ skills and prepare them for entry-level positions in the animation industry. VFS’s hands-on approach and industry-focused curriculum have led to high job placement rates for graduates.

7. School of Visual Arts (SVA)
Located in New York City, SVA offers a Bachelor of Fine Arts (BFA) in Animation that covers both traditional and digital animation methods. The program emphasizes storytelling, character design, and animation theory, providing students with a well-rounded education in animation. SVA’s proximity to the vibrant animation industry in New York City offers students unique opportunities for internships and networking.

8. Animation Mentor
For aspiring animators who prefer online learning, Animation Mentor offers a range of specialized animation courses taught by industry professionals. The courses cover topics such as character animation, creature animation, and 3D modeling, allowing students to focus on their areas of interest. Animation Mentor’s flexible schedule and personalized feedback make it an attractive option for students looking to advance their animation skills from the comfort of their own home.
